14th/20th Hussars NCO's Arm Badge
A bi-metal arm badge for a junior non-commissioned officer of The 14th/20th Hussars with two lug fastenings (east and west). Linaker & Dine 36.4B.
Note: David Linaker & Gordon Dine, in their book on Cavalry Warrant Officers' And Non-Commissioned Officers' Arm Badges, say this "treated gilding metal oval with black eagle" badge was introduced for lance corporals in 1957. read more

16th Lancers Cap Badge
A rare, bi-metal, cap badge for The 16th Lancers with a long slider fastening (bent) and 'sweathole' construction. KK780.
Note: This is the Edwardian version where the title reads Queen's Lancers, as did the Victorian version. The title changed to read The Queen's Lancers around 1905 so this badge dates to circa 1902-05 only. read more
